Specifications

21 units built
Click here and here

Coventry Climax FWA "85", straight 4 cyl, 4 stroke, petrol engine
1098cc, 72.4 x 66.68 mm
9.8 : 1
63.5 kW / 85 hp @ 6250 rpm
100 Nm / 74 ft-lb @ 4400 rpm
drop forged steel crankshaft with 3 main bearings
2 valves / cylinder, SOHC
aspiration, natural with 2 x 1-1/2" SU H4 horizontal carburetors
distributor ignition
water cooled

Coventry Climax FWB "100", straight 4 cyl, 4 stroke, petrol engine
1459cc, 62.2 x 61.0 mm
8.6:1
101 bhp / 75 KW @ 6000 rpm
125 Nm / 92 ft-lb @ 4400 rpm
forged steel crankshaft with 3 main bearings
2 valves / cylinder, SOHC
aspiration, natural with 2 x SU horizontal carburetors
water cooled

Coventry Climax FWMA, straight 4 cyl, 4 stroke, petrol engine
742cc, 76.2 x 80.0 mm
2 valves / cylinder, DOHC
water cooled

front suspension: double wishbones with coil springs and telescopic shock absorbers
rear suspension: Chapman struts with radius trailing arms and fixed length half-shaft, coil springs and telescopic shock absorbers
